  • GRUDGE Definition Meaning - Merriam-Webster
    grudge implies a harbored feeling of resentment or ill will that seeks satisfaction Verb I don't grudge paying my share I don't grudge her the opportunities she has been given Noun She still has a grudge against him for the way he treated her in school He has nursed a grudge against his former boss for years I don't bear him any grudges

  • Grudge - definition of grudge by The Free Dictionary
    1 a feeling of ill will or resentment because of some real or fancied wrong 2 to give or permit with reluctance: They grudged us every day we were away 3 to resent the good fortune of (another); begrudge 4 Obs to feel dissatisfaction or ill will
